IS IT TRUE? December 30, 2010

IS IT TRUE that Evansville Mayor Jonathan Weinzapfel finally thinks he is ready for the big leagues?…that Mole #3 tells us that Mayor Weinzapfel has decided to tell his staff and to publically announce himself as a candidate for the office of Governor of Indiana?…that the election for Governor of Indiana will be held in November of 2012?…that Mayor Weinzapfel has seen the wisdom in Rick Davis’s move to make an early announcement?….that Mr. Davis continues to serve admirably in his capacity of the Treasurer of Vanderburgh County while running for Mayor of Evansville? … that we expect Jonathan Weinzapfel to focus on his elected job of Mayor of Evansville for the next year and to make this 22 month campaign for Governor his second job?…there are plenty of recently exposed “loose ends” created by our Mayor that he needs to spend the next year tying up to prove that he is ready for higher office?…that we will make that list another day?

IS IT TRUE that Troy Tornatta who was recently defeated by Marsha Abell in the race to retain his seat on the Vanderburgh County Commissioners will be opposing Mr. Rick Davis in seeking the Democratic nomination for Mayor of Evansville?…that Tornatta will have the blessings of Mayor Weinzapfel in his quest to be Mayor?…that the race for the Democratic nomination will be a referendum on old school politics represented by Mr. Tornatta and the new Kennedy Club style of Democrat?

IS IT TRUE that Lloyd Winnecke will soon announce his candidacy for the Republican nomination for Mayor of Evansville?…that it is expected that he will run unopposed?…that unless some new face emerges from the sea of Republicans that Mr. Winnecke may just coast to the nomination and enjoy watching a good battle between his long time co office holder Commissioner Tornatta and Rick Davis?….that 2011 is shaping up to be an interesting year in Evansville politics?
